Top 10 Automotive in Hemmant QLD

Black Label Marine Pty Ltd
Black Label Marine Pty Ltd
Shed 13B 28 Wyuna crt
Hemmant, QLD
Australia
Hemmant Automotive

Results 1 - 1 of 1